Hi ,
Am looking for a find command with arguments that would help me to search fast through a deep dierctory structure .
Am using hpux 11iv2.

Re: Reg find command for deep directory structure
What are you searching for? A filename or property?
find path -name "*foo*"
Of contents of files?
find path -exec fgrep bar {} +

Re: Reg find command for deep directory structure
>I need to find ONLY all month end directories with its contents
/ftp/gb/B2/kv/cations/001/reports/20090131
/ftp/gb/B2/kv/cations/650/reports/20091231
Then you can just use nested Composite patterns:
ls /ftp/gb/B2/kv/cations/*/reports/?(??????31|?????(04|06|09|11)30|????0228)
(In leap years you would have a problem with 0229.)
Or you can toss this pattern stuff and use awk to find the last entry for each month.
